The Myth and Reality of BIOS Backdoor Passwords

The idea of a universal “backdoor password” that unlocks any Toshiba Satellite BIOS is a persistent myth. While it’s tempting to believe in a simple solution to a forgotten password, the reality is far more complex. Manufacturers like Toshiba employ various security measures to prevent unauthorized access to the BIOS, and a single master password simply doesn’t exist for modern systems.

The concept of backdoor passwords stems from older BIOS versions, where manufacturers sometimes included default or “engineer” passwords for internal testing and maintenance. These passwords were intended for technicians and developers and were not meant for general user access. Over time, many of these default passwords became publicly known, leading to the perception of a universal backdoor.

Modern Toshiba Satellite laptops do not typically have easily accessible backdoor passwords. Security protocols have significantly evolved, making older methods ineffective. Attempting to use outdated or generic passwords often proves futile and can potentially cause further problems.

Why Backdoor Passwords are Rare and Unreliable

Several factors contribute to the rarity and unreliability of backdoor passwords in contemporary Toshiba Satellite BIOS implementations:

  • Advanced Security Measures: Modern BIOS chips utilize sophisticated encryption and authentication techniques that render simple password bypasses ineffective.

  • Customized BIOS Versions: Toshiba often customizes the BIOS for specific Satellite models, further complicating the possibility of a universal backdoor password. Each model may have unique security configurations.

  • Security Patches and Updates: BIOS updates frequently address security vulnerabilities, including potential backdoor exploits. Applying these updates strengthens the system’s defenses against unauthorized access.

  • Hardware-Level Security: Some Toshiba Satellite laptops incorporate hardware-level security features, such as Trusted Platform Modules (TPM), that add another layer of protection to the BIOS.

Alternatives to Backdoor Passwords for BIOS Access

When faced with a forgotten Toshiba Satellite BIOS password, several legitimate alternatives exist:

  • Contacting Toshiba Support: This is often the best starting point. Toshiba support may be able to assist in recovering or resetting the password, provided you can verify ownership of the laptop. They will likely require proof of purchase and may involve a service fee.

  • Professional Data Recovery Services: Specialized data recovery services have the tools and expertise to bypass or reset BIOS passwords in certain situations. However, this can be an expensive option.

  • CMOS Battery Reset: This involves physically removing the CMOS battery (a small coin-shaped battery on the motherboard) to reset the BIOS settings to their default values. This is a delicate procedure and should only be attempted by experienced users or qualified technicians. Improper handling can damage the motherboard. Note that while this might clear the password, it will also reset all other BIOS settings to factory defaults, which could affect system performance.

  • BIOS Flashing (Advanced Users Only): Flashing the BIOS involves rewriting the BIOS firmware. This is a risky procedure that can render your laptop unusable if done incorrectly. It should only be attempted by experienced users who understand the risks involved. It’s crucial to use the correct BIOS image for your specific Toshiba Satellite model and follow the manufacturer’s instructions carefully.

Risks Associated with Searching for Backdoor Passwords

Searching for and attempting to use backdoor passwords from untrusted sources carries significant risks:

  • Malware and Viruses: Websites claiming to offer backdoor passwords often contain malicious software. Downloading files from these sources can infect your laptop with viruses, Trojans, or other malware.

  • Phishing Scams: Some websites use the promise of backdoor passwords to lure users into providing personal information or login credentials, leading to identity theft or account compromise.

  • Damage to the BIOS: Incorrectly attempting to reset the BIOS or flash the BIOS with the wrong firmware can damage the BIOS chip, rendering your laptop unusable.

  • Voiding Warranty: Tampering with the BIOS or attempting unauthorized password resets can void your laptop’s warranty.

Understanding BIOS Password Security Measures

Delving deeper into the security mechanisms makes one appreciate why backdoor passwords are not feasible solutions. BIOS passwords are not stored in plain text. They are typically hashed using cryptographic algorithms. Hashing transforms the password into a seemingly random string of characters. When you enter the password, it’s hashed and compared to the stored hash. If they match, access is granted. This method prevents someone from simply reading the password directly from the BIOS chip.

Additionally, many modern BIOS implementations include features like password lockout. After a certain number of incorrect attempts, the BIOS will lock access, preventing further attempts to guess the password. This adds another layer of security against brute-force attacks. These are attacks where software rapidly tries many different password combinations.
